Lechuga para la vida - Arduino 101 basado automatizado controlador para hidroponía, aeroponía, acuaponia, etc.. Curie de Intel (8 / 17 paso)

Paso 8: Temperatura y Sensor de humedad

¿POR QUÉ PARA HUMEDAD/TEMPERATURA?

  • El impacto de la humedad/temperatura varía dependiendo de la planta que están creciendo. Pero aquí es una idea global:

    • Humedad ideal es de 40% a 80%, con el 50% siendo el mejor para el crecimiento.

      • Plantas no se polinizan en configuraciones de baja humedad
      • Planta no puede respirar en configuración de alta humedad
    • Temperatura ideal es de 40° F a 90° F
      • Hay cultivos de temporada fresca y cultivos de temporada caliente.
      • Rango de temperatura ideal también tiende a cambiar durante la y y la noche
      • Lechuga por ejemplo:
        • Mejor especificaciones es 60° F a 70° F durante el día y 50 ° F a 60° F en la noche

NOTAS

  • Ver imagen para cableado

    • VCC de 5V
    • GND a GND
    • DATOS al Pin Digital 2
  • Instalar la biblioteca DHT
    • Vaya a Sketch > incluyen Biblioteca > gestionar bibliotecas...
    • Buscar la palabra "DHT"
    • Instalar "DHT Sensor biblioteca"
    • Bosquejo de cerrar y volver a abrir para instalar correctamente completa biblioteca
  • El código adjunto trabaja con DHT11, DHT21 y DHT22.
  • Si no DHT11, debe cambiar el modelo de sensor está en la línea de código "#define DHTTYPE"

SENSOR UTILIZADO

Fantasma YoYo Arduino compatible DHT11 análogo de temperatura y humedad Sensor de Enlace de Amazonas

  • Características del sensor

  • Calibrado de salida de señal digital con el sensor de temperatura y humedad
  • Alta confiabilidad y excelente estabilidad a largo plazo.
  • Está conectado a un microcontrolador de 8 bits de alto rendimiento.
  • Incluye un elemento resistivo y un sentido de medidores de temperatura NTC mojados.
  • Tiene excelente calidad, respuesta rápida, capacidad antiinterferente y ventajas de performance de alto costo.
  • Los coeficientes de calibración almacenados en la memoria de programa OTP, sensores internos detectan señales en el proceso, debemos llamar a estos coeficientes de calibración.
  • El sistema de interfaz en serie solo-alambre está integrado para ser rápido y fácil.
  • Tamaño pequeño, baja hasta 20 metros de distancia de transmisión de energía, señal
  • Conexión conveniente, paquetes especiales se pueden proporcionar según las necesidades de los usuarios.

EL CÓDIGO DE

 #include DHT.h> //Due to web tags, I can't include symbol < on this line#define DHTPIN 2 //What digital pin we're connected to #define DHTTYPE DHT11 //Sensor model DHT dht(DHTPIN, DHTTYPE);void setup() { Serial.begin(9600); Serial.println("DHTxx test!"); dht.begin(); }void loop() { // Wait a few seconds between measurements. delay(2000); // Reading temperature or humidity takes about 250 milliseconds! // Sensor readings may also be up to 2 seconds 'old'(very slow sensor) float h = dht.readHumidity(); // Read temperature as Celsius (the default) float t = dht.readTemperature(); // Read temperature as Fahrenheit (isFahrenheit = true) float f = dht.readTemperature(true); // Check if any reads failed and exit early (to try again). if (isnan(h) || isnan(t) || isnan(f)) { Serial.println("Failed to read from DHT sensor!"); return; } // Compute heat index in Fahrenheit (the default) float hif = dht.computeHeatIndex(f, h); // Compute heat index in Celsius (isFahreheit = false) float hic = dht.computeHeatIndex(t, h, false); Serial.print("Humidity: "); Serial.print(h); Serial.print(" %\t"); Serial.print("Temperature: "); Serial.print(t); Serial.print(" *C "); Serial.print(f); Serial.print(" *F\t"); Serial.print("Heat index: "); Serial.print(hic); Serial.print(" *C "); Serial.print(hif); Serial.println(" *F"); } 

Artículos Relacionados

Arduino debido basado en controlador de Fractal Audio Axe-FX II

Arduino debido basado en controlador de Fractal Audio Axe-FX II

He utilizado efectos de guitarra y preamps como el Digitech GSP-21 y el SGX2000 arte en mi plataforma vivo desde principios de los noventa. Aunque grandes unidades durante su período, ya era hora de una actualización. Después de leer algunos comentar
Arduino UNO basado en controlador de pantalla de LED de HUB75

Arduino UNO basado en controlador de pantalla de LED de HUB75

Se trata de los 5x5cm personalizado placa de Arduino UNO, que permite la sencilla conexión a pantallas de interfaz LED HUB75.Si no está familiarizado con estas pantallas se puede comprar uno de Adafruit PANEL de matriz RGB LED 16 X 32, o de Aliexpres
Arduino UNO / Arduino 101 DIN rail caja y placa

Arduino UNO / Arduino 101 DIN rail caja y placa

¿Desea instalar su Arduino proyecto Genuino en un armario? Mayo nosotros podemos ayudarle!Nuestros kits DIY Open ArduiBox no sólo son adecuados para albergar una placa Arduino y montaje en carril DIN. ArduiBox viene con un tablero y un regulador de v
Revisión de Arduino 101

Revisión de Arduino 101

Hola todo el mundo!Para no hacer un instructable durante un buen rato, hasta las pruebas aren't aquí sin embargo, decidí hacer una revisión sobre el Arduino 101.Así que una historia es muy interesante. Compré esta tarjeta muy pronto ya que estaba rea
Arduino 101 y Visuino: Control de LED de Smartphone con Bluetooth LE

Arduino 101 y Visuino: Control de LED de Smartphone con Bluetooth LE

101 de Arduino es un microcontrolador potente, que también viene con construido en acelerómetro, giroscopio, termómetro y Bluetooth LE (BLE). El Bluetooth hace particularmente bueno cabe para el desarrollo de la IoT y control remoto de teléfonos inte
Fundamentos de Arduino 101

Fundamentos de Arduino 101

El propósito de este instructable es introducir el bosquejo escrito fundamentos a los recién llegados al mundo de Arduino. Se pretende ser una guía de principiantes que incluye explicación detallada de las declaraciones básicas y funciones. La mayorí
Arduino Windows y el controlador de PS3

Arduino Windows y el controlador de PS3

esta guía le mostrará cómo convertir su Arduino Uno en un controlador de Windows/PS3. Es totalmente configurable y puede cambiar la entrada y salida a cualquier botón que desee. Esto significa que puede un nunchuck de wii hasta el gancho y jugar con
Un manitas de .NET basado en controlador de temperatura de fermentación

Un manitas de .NET basado en controlador de temperatura de fermentación

En este artículo demuestra el diseño y fabricación de una pantalla táctil basado en controlador de temperatura de fermentación automática usando una combinación de hardware y software comercial y personalizado. Me han colado hogar para más de 20 años
Cómo raíz corredores fresales para hidroponía, acuaponia o suelo

Cómo raíz corredores fresales para hidroponía, acuaponia o suelo

Cómo raíz fresas para hidroponía, acuaponia o sueloSólo una solución que se me ocurrió para una mujer que no quería tomar abajo sus cestas colgantes de fresas a los corredores cuelgan la raíz.  Mi método es diferente a cualquier otra y lo haría cualq
Arduino basado automatizado de Control de iluminación

Arduino basado automatizado de Control de iluminación

este es mi segundo instructable. Quiero compartir algunos de los básicos con las cosas que hice usando la arduino estoy tan ocupado últimamente. Luego tuve la oportunidad de tener este tiempo libre... inspirado por mi ex alumno y una liga co compañer
GSM basado automatizado sistema de riego con lluvia-Gun

GSM basado automatizado sistema de riego con lluvia-Gun

Era digital moderna de nuestro siglo XXI necesita automatización en cada sector. Combinación de la tecnología para aumentar la credibilidad de una tecnología de otra no es una muy buena idea. India es un país donde la agricultura es el principal y gr
Mini CNC Arduino basado & Adafruit controlador Motor L293D v1 y 2 de la máquina * Mini Stepper reproductor de CD #1

Mini CNC Arduino basado & Adafruit controlador Motor L293D v1 y 2 de la máquina * Mini Stepper reproductor de CD #1

En este proyecto le mostrará cómo construir fácilmente su propio Arduino Mini CNC Plotter de bajo coste!Para eje X e Y, vamos a utilizar paso a paso, los motores y los carriles de dos dvd/cd-rom! Área de impresión será máximo 4x4cm.Paso 1: El Video e
Arduino navegador basado en control remoto (linux)

Arduino navegador basado en control remoto (linux)

tenemos niños.  Amo a pedacitos pero que manten ocultos el control remoto para el satélite y la TV cuando ponen canales para niños.Después de este suceso sobre una base diaria durante varios años y después de mi querida esposa que me permitía tener u
Una red Wi-Fi basado en controlador para los trenes modelo, Halloween Props, monitoreo de energía y más!

Una red Wi-Fi basado en controlador para los trenes modelo, Halloween Props, monitoreo de energía y más!

Personas se han acostumbrado al uso de sus dispositivos portátiles para realizar todo tipo de cosas de ver vídeos, juegos, para la gestión de su lista de compras.  Pero a pesar de la popularidad de estos dispositivos, los fabricantes, los hackers y a